Mercure Antwerp City South
51.19435, 4.406046The 4-star Mercure Antwerp City South hotel is nestled in the heart of the business Antwerp district and offers a bureau de change and a lift. Located at a distance of 2.5 km from Stadpark, this environmentally friendly hotel comprises 210 rooms and 4 restaurants.
Location
Nestled in the heart of Antwerp, near a tram stop, the non-smoking accommodation is within 25 minutes' walk of Nachtegalen Park. Guests can visit AH Karel Oomsstraat, which is merely 6 minutes' walk away, and the red sandstone MAS Museum which is at a distance of 4.3 km from the Mercure Antwerp City South. A family vacation to Antwerp will become more exciting if you visit the defined ZOO Antwerpen lying at a distance of 3.1 km from the property.
For those travelling from afar, Deurne airport is 10 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
The spacious rooms at the Mercure Antwerp City South are furnished with a sofa and a work desk, and feature a mini-fridge-bar and coffee/tea making facilities. Guests can use a sauna and a shower/bath combination, along with guest toiletries. A separate toilet and a shower are available in private bathrooms.
Eat & Drink
This Antwerp hotel serves breakfast in the restaurant from 11:00 on weekends. The onsite restaurant is open from 06:30 to 10:00. Guests can enjoy the lounge bar on premises. Serving Belgian meals, Colmar Wezenberg lies just a short stroll from the hotel.
Leisure & Business
At the property you may pay for a fitness centre and a sauna. At the Mercure Antwerp City South, guests can also benefit from fitness classes provided at a fitness club.
